What is the US District Court Copy Request Form?
The US District Court Copy Request Form is utilized to obtain copies of court documents from the Southern District of Indiana. This form plays a crucial role in facilitating access to important legal materials. Through this form, individuals can request the necessary copies of court documents, ensuring compliance with legal protocols. The specific courts relevant to this form are found within the jurisdiction of the Southern District of Indiana.

Who Needs the US District Court Copy Request Form?
A variety of individuals and entities may require the US District Court Copy Request Form. This includes:
-
Lawyers seeking client-related documents
-
Defendants needing files for their legal defense
-
Plaintiffs requiring evidence for their cases
-
Researchers or journalists interested in court proceedings
The form might be necessary in scenarios such as appealing a case, preparing for trial, or gathering materials for a legal study.

Who is eligible to use the US District Court Copy Request Form?
Anyone needing copies of documents from the Southern District of Indiana, including individuals, legal representatives, and entities involved in a case, can use this form.
What supporting documents are needed for submission?
Generally, you may need to provide a form of identification along with the request, along with any specific case details requested on the form to facilitate processing.
How can I submit the completed copy request form?
The form should be submitted according to instructions on pdfFiller, which may provide options for electronic submission or require mailing to the court's designated address.
What fees are associated with the document request?
Fees for copying, certification, exemplification, and retrieval are outlined in the form. Ensure to review these fees carefully and include payment with your submission.
How long does it typically take to process a copy request?
Processing times may vary based on court workloads; however, it generally takes several days to weeks to fulfill a document copy request. Check with the court for more specific timelines.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include incomplete sections, incorrect case details, and failure to sign the form. Carefully review all entries before submission to avoid delays.
Can I request copies for multiple cases using one form?
Typically, you need to submit a separate request for each case. Ensure to clarify this when filling out the form to avoid processing issues.
